As organizations expand their use of AWS, adopt additional clouds, and continue to operate on-premises infrastructure, protecting the network becomes more complicated. Security teams must manage traffic moving among users, applications, data centers, branches, and cloud workloads.

AWS-native security controls provide effective protection for workloads running within AWS. But hybrid and multi-cloud environments can introduce security requirements that extend beyond any individual cloud environment.

This creates a hybrid and multi-cloud security gap when controls, policies, and visibility become fragmented across environments.

Where hybrid and multi-cloud security becomes challenging

As hybrid and multi-cloud environments grow, security teams may encounter several challenges:
  • Inconsistent policies and configurations across AWS, other public clouds, and on-premises infrastructure
  • Limited visibility into traffic moving among cloud workloads, applications, users, and data centers
  • Difficulty inspecting east-west traffic between workloads and north-south traffic entering or leaving the network
  • Broad VPN access that can expose more resources than individual users or devices require
  • Operational complexity from managing separate security tools and consoles
  • Latency and inconsistent application performance caused by backhauling traffic to a central inspection point
Together, these issues can increase risk, complicate compliance, and slow threat response.

Closing the gap with FortiGate VM

FortiGate VM complements cloud-native controls by providing enterprise security capabilities across AWS, other public clouds, and on-premises environments. Because it runs on virtualized infrastructure, it can be deployed close to cloud workloads and scaled as requirements evolve.

FortiGate VM helps security teams:
  • Inspect east-west and north-south traffic: Apply advanced inspection to traffic moving among workloads, virtual networks, users, and external destinations.
  • Reduce lateral-movement risk: Segment workloads and control communications between applications and network zones to help contain compromised accounts or systems.
  • Unify security management: Centrally manage policies and workflows across AWS, other clouds, and on-premises environments to reduce configuration drift and simplify compliance.
  • Improve hybrid and multi-cloud visibility: Gain a more unified view of traffic and security events across cloud and traditional infrastructure.
  • Modernize application access: Use Zero Trust Network Access to grant access to specific applications based on identity, device posture, and policy instead of providing broad network-level access.
  • Optimize traffic inspection: Place security controls closer to applications and workloads to help reduce unnecessary traffic backhauling, latency, and performance bottlenecks.
FortiGate VM is designed to complement, not replace cloud-native controls. This allows organizations to choose the right security service for each workload while maintaining a coordinated security architecture across AWS, other clouds, and on-premises environments.
